Subject: Legacy Pricing Adjustment — Finance Review

Dear Executive Team,

Following the Q3 review, Finance recommends a 6% price increase for legacy customers on the Corvel Suite, effective next fiscal quarter. Modelling by Dana Ostrech's team suggests churn of under 2% if we pair the increase with a twelve-month rate lock. Notification letters would go out sixty days in advance, with regional exceptions for the Ellsworth accounts. Full sensitivity tables are attached. The confidential summary of the broader plan follows below.

internal memo for kawip-hadug: Headcount on the Wenwyn team goes from 7 to 140 by the end of January. Gross margin on Wenwyn came in at 20 percent against a plan of 15 percent.

Subject: Liftwise simulator — nightly run flagged

On-call: the Liftwise elevator-dispatch simulator's nightly regression run finished with two scenarios outside tolerance (morning-peak lobby clearing and fire-recall sequencing). Neither blocks the release, but both should be triaged before tomorrow's cut. Replays are archived in the usual bucket; the scenario seeds are deterministic, so a local rerun should reproduce exactly. If you need to bisect, start from last Thursday's green run. The failing simulator build is referenced below.

session token of yajof-bagef = htk4_937d

## Formula sandbox tuning

User-supplied formulas in Gridmoor execute inside a restricted interpreter with hard ceilings on time, memory, and call depth. Reviewers should confirm any change to these ceilings is justified in the PR description, since raising them widens the abuse surface. Defaults were chosen from production traces. The current limits are as follows.

limits module of tafog-fawip:
WEIGHTS = {
    "julix": 57,
    "lamys": 992,
    "kasvan": 209,
    "quenok": 750,
    "alddor": 259,
    "oliath": 1009,
    "wenix": 815,
}